MediaTek Delivers Vital Security Fixes for Broad Chipset Range, Targeting High-Risk Exploits
MediaTek has rolled out a series of essential security updates aimed at neutralizing six major vulnerabilities discovered in its chipsets, which are used in an extensive variety of consumer electronics—from smartphones and tablets to smart TVs, AIoT devices, and audio systems.
The issues were detailed in MediaTek’s May 2025 Product Security Bulletin, which underscores the critical nature of the threats and their potential to affect millions of devices running Android and other platforms.
Major Threat: Remote Denial-of-Service Exploit (CVE-2025-20666)
Topping the list is CVE-2025-20666, a remote denial-of-service vulnerability stemming from a reachable assertion in the Modem subsystem (CWE-617). With a high-severity rating, this flaw allows attackers to crash affected devices remotely by exploiting an unhandled exception—no user action or elevated permissions required.
According to MediaTek, a compromised device could result simply from being within range of a rogue base station. This flaw affects over 30 MediaTek chipsets, including high-profile models like MT6833, MT6877, and MT6893, all utilizing Modem NR15 firmware.

Additional Security Risks with Medium Severity
Alongside the critical DoS flaw, MediaTek addressed five medium-severity bugs, each posing distinct risks:
- CVE-2025-20667 – Weak Encryption in Modem Layer: A flaw in encryption implementation (CWE-326) could expose sensitive data if a device connects to an attacker-controlled base station. Affects chipsets using Modem LR12A, LR13, NR15–NR17R firmware.
- CVE-2025-20671 & CVE-2025-20668 – Memory Corruption via Out-of-Bounds Write: Located in the thermal and SCP components (CWE-787), these vulnerabilities may be exploited for local privilege escalation if attackers already have system-level access. Android 14 and 15 systems are particularly at risk.
- CVE-2025-20670 – Bypass Through Improper Certificate Validation: This issue (CWE-295) in the Modem stack could allow rogue base stations to bypass permissions and extract protected data.
- CVE-2025-20665 – Leakage of Device Identifiers: The devinfo component suffers from improper file/directory protections (CWE-538), potentially allowing local access to unique identifiers. This affects devices running Android 13 to 15.
What Users and OEMs Should Do
MediaTek has worked with hardware manufacturers under its coordinated disclosure policy, giving them advanced access to patch the vulnerabilities before public release. OEMs were notified at least two months prior to this announcement.
If your device is powered by a MediaTek chipset, it’s critical to check for and install the latest firmware or system updates issued by your device manufacturer. Delaying these updates could leave devices vulnerable to silent, remote exploitation.
Given the nature of CVE-2025-20666, even a passive device with no user interaction can be taken offline or compromised—making timely patching essential.
